Day two of this year’s MBFWA experience started and ended with my first show at 5pm – Manning Cartell.
I chose not to take time off from work this year to attend Fashion Week on a full-time basis, and a result of this is that I have had to be very selective about the shows I choose to see as I am only really able to attend just one show per day.
Anyways – back to the details; held at a truly industrial space that is The Shed at Carriageworks, Manning Cartell‘s SS13 collection, Fate & Chance featured a variety of design elements that ranged from futuristic aesthetics – structured and firm shiny fabrics – to more feminine components with sheer, layered netting and lace creating delicate-hard juxtapositions.
Fate & Chance is definitely a collection that I can envision myself picking not just a few, but multiple looks from – without any issues; however I’m not too sure my credit card would agree with me though…
